CI note — Fernwick session refresh flake

Heads up: the session-token refresh test in the Fernwick gateway suite keeps failing on the nightly runner but passes locally. Looks like the mock clock isn't advancing past the token TTL, so the refresh path never fires. Not a real vuln as far as I can tell, but flagging for review. The failing run's identifier is pasted below.

build token for kagaf-hahof: htk14_9d3d4d26d7d8de

To: Dispatch Desk. Subject: Exhibition pieces on loan — return transport. The four framed pieces on loan from the Merrowgate Collection are ready for return: wrapped, corner-protected, and crated per the loan agreement. Condition reports are signed and enclosed in the document wallet taped to crate A. Records team has logged each piece against the loan register. Transport must be climate-neutral and completed within one working day. The courier hand-over instruction is as follows:

dispatch memo: the ulaox normir courier leaves the praath ledger at gate 9753 under passcode 639705

## Account Recovery — Trailnote Offline Mode

When a surveyor's Trailnote app has been offline for 30+ days, their local credentials expire and sync refuses to resume. Don't make them wipe the device — all their unsynced field data lives there! Instead, open the support console, pick "Offline Reinstate," and enter their handle. The console will ask for the support team's shared recovery passphrase before issuing a reinstatement token. Use the one below.

unlock words, bagaf-fajeg: zorael-kelax-fraath-quenix-eliok-sileth-aldmir-wenir-druiel